Trenching Service in Atlanta, GA

Trenching services involve digging narrow, deep channels into the ground to install or repair underground utilities, drainage systems, or fencing. These projects are common for property owners who need to lay electrical lines, water or sewer pipes, or establish underground wiring for landscaping features. Before requesting trenching, property owners should consider the location and depth required for the project, as well as any existing underground utilities that may be affected. It’s also important to understand local regulations or permits that might apply to excavation work on the property.

Property owners often seek trenching services for projects such as installing new irrigation systems, running cables for outdoor lighting, or preparing land for fencing or landscaping. Clarifying the scope of the project, including the length and depth of trenches needed, helps ensure the work meets specific needs. Additionally, understanding the soil conditions and potential obstacles on the property can influence the planning and execution of trenching work, making it essential to discuss these details before proceeding.

Common Trenching Service Jobs

Foundation Excavation - prepares the site for new construction or repairs by removing soil and debris.

Drainage Trenching - installs underground drainage systems to prevent water buildup around the property.

Utility Trenching - creates pathways for underground electrical, water, or gas lines to connect structures.

Landscape Trenching - shapes and installs irrigation or sprinkler lines to support lawn and garden areas.

Fence and Boundary Trenching - digs trenches for fence posts or property boundary markers.

Retaining Wall Foundations - excavates for the base of retaining walls to stabilize slopes and prevent erosion.

Trenching Service Questions

What is trenching service used for? Trenching is often used to install utility lines, drainage systems, or irrigation pipes across a property.

What types of projects require trenching? Projects like laying cables, setting up sprinkler systems, or installing fencing typically need trenching services.

How deep are trenches usually dug? Trenches are commonly dug between 6 inches to 3 feet deep, depending on the project requirements.

What should property owners consider before trenching? It's important to identify underground utilities and plan the trench location to avoid existing structures or systems.
